About the Job:

About The Job:

Sandy Spring Bank is currently recruiting for a BSA/AML Data Analytics. The BSA/AML Data Analytics is responsible for uncovering enterprise insights and driving business results using more innovative data analytics. The focus will be the collection of organizational technology capabilities, including business intelligence, data management, and data assurance, that help our clients drive innovation, growth, and change within Sandy Spring Bank to keep up with the changing nature of customers and technology.

MAJOR JOB ACCOUNTABILITIES:

  • Utilizing AML systems (including data mapping and profiling, and system tuning and optimization) and leading sanctions and RPA systems, and implementation of these systems
  • Providing end-to-end implementation of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and sanctions systems and platforms- Verafin User a Plus
  • Collaborating with business development teams responsible for writing and presenting proposals to prospective clients, leveraging PC applications including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Project and Lotus notes
  • Implement enterprise content and data management applications that improve operational effectiveness and provide impactful data analytics and insights
  • Navigate various analytics applications to get the most value out of their technology investment and foster confidence in their business intelligence
  • Demonstrate critical thinking and the ability to bring order to unstructured problems.
  • Use various tools and techniques to extract insights from current industry or sector trends.
  • Review your work and that of others for quality, accuracy, and relevance.
  • Use straightforward communication in a structured way when influencing and connecting with others
  • Use feedback and reflection to develop self-awareness and personal strengths and address development areas

Required Skills:

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ES:

  • Five years of experience is required. Experience in Risk, AMK, Fraud Analytics and a strong IT background is preferred.
  • Experience with case management platforms is a plus. Exposure to platform implementation/enhancement environment is a plus.
  • A degree in Computer and Information Science, Computer and Information Science & Accounting, Economics, Economics and Finance, Economics and Finance & Technology, Engineering, Operations Management/Research, Statistics
  • Demonstrating an aptitude for conducting quantitative and qualitative analyses of large and complex data as it relates to the project requirements in the Risk, financial crimes and AML space
  • Supporting practice management for a specific operation or process in a consultative environment
  • Managing and contributing to project planning, engagement administration, budget management, and completing engagement work stream(s) successfully.
  • Must have demonstrated experience and be comfortable making critical decisions in a time-sensitive and regulatory mandated environment
  • Testing, Validating, and Interpretation of data across multiple platforms throughout
  • Must have demonstrated experience in applying strong problem solving, judgment, and analysis to detect and deter money-laundering activities
  • Ability to work independently but cohesively within a team of specialized associates, with high integrity and ethics
  • Highly self-motivated with excellent communication skills and the ability to manage and analyze data
  • Excellent written and oral formats, including presentations to regulators, auditors, analysts, and senior managers
  • Exceptional analytical skills, judgment, attention to detail, and ability to prioritize tasks and work under pressure
